frontends icon indicating copy to clipboard operation
frontends copied to clipboard

[FEATURE] Ability to use nuxt module or nuxt layer for composables and cms-base

Open mkucmus opened this issue 1 year ago • 1 comments

Description

Provide an ability of using our packages as layers or modules to the end user by another export of a package.

Use Case

more flexible packages

Proposed Solution

export different build version with appropriate suffix:

  • packageName/nuxt3-module
  • packageName/nuxt3-layer

for instance: @shopware-pwa/composables-next/nuxt3-module

Alternatives Considered

No response

Additional Context

No response

mkucmus avatar Jan 18 '24 08:01 mkucmus

@mkucmus @BrocksiNet Is this somehow related in the scope of the Themes in CFE epic? if not, could you provide a bit more context and suggest some priority on this? fow now, I have added a minimal priority as suggestion

gianfranco-l avatar May 15 '25 14:05 gianfranco-l

I suppose we can close this, @mkucmus?

BrocksiNet avatar Dec 11 '25 12:12 BrocksiNet

I suppose we can close this, @mkucmus?

that's correct. we smoothly moved to make composables and cms-base-layer as nuxt layers 💪🏼

mkucmus avatar Dec 11 '25 12:12 mkucmus